There’s a certain stage in life where an individual starts to experience things that they’ve never seen before. Bodies change, brains develop, passions emerge, and new friendships are made. At the edge of all the chaos is Charlie, a boy who has just entered the strange world of high school. The Perks of Being a Wallflower follows Charlie’s expedition through the awkward teenage years, as he battles the fight between living his life and running away from it.

Lia and Beckett's Abracadabra is a fictional novel written by Amy Noelle Parks. Lia Sawyer is a 17-year-old that loves magic. She struggles to get approval from her parents, who would prefer for her to go into environmental science, or at least something more sophisticated like playing piano (as her sister does). On top of all that, Lia needs to find a way to prove to society that girls can be more than just pretty assistants.

To Belly, everything good and magical happens during the summer. During the summer she stays in a beach house in the town of Cousins with her mom, brother, Susannah, and most importantly Jeremiah and Conrad. They’re the boys Belly has known since her very first summer in Cousins and she’s experienced almost everything with them. However, this summer everything keeps changing, and the more everything changes, the more it all ends up just the way it should’ve been all along.

Catching Fire is the sequel to The Hunger Games and is written by Suzanne Collins. Katniss and Peeta have survived the Hunger Games and arrive to District 12 safely. However, they must now participate in the Victory Tour and travel throughout the districts. While they do so, Katniss and Peeta start to sense a rebellion stirring within the uneasy district people of Panem.

The Ballad of Songbirds and Snakes is a prequel to The Hunger Games series. Suzanne Collins returns to write the origin story of an 18-year-old Coriolanus Snow, who finds himself shooting for the stars by mentoring a tribute in the 10th annual Hunger Games. However, the odds are against him; the once-magnificent Snow family has fallen on hard times, and Coriolanus has been assigned the humiliating assignment of the girl tribute from District 12.

American Royals by Katharine McGee is young adult fiction. When America won the Revolutionary war, George Washington was offered the crown and he accepted. Now, two and a half centuries later, what if America had a royal family? Princess Beatrice is getting closer to becoming the first queen regnant of America. No one cares about the spare sister unless to bash; Princess Samantha doesn’t care and lives her life the way she wants, except about the one boy she can’t have. Then, there’s the other twin, Prince Jefferson.

Lord of the Flies by William Golding is a thrilling story about a group of young boys found stranded on a deserted island. Together they found themselves developing rules and a system of organization to try and remain civil. But without “grownups,” their attempt to govern themselves becomes violent and unorthodox. Although this novel is a challenging read, it is a story all children have dreamed about before. Its bone-chilling reality, however, makes readers second guess their fantasy of living on an island.

Long Way Down by Jason Reynolds follows a story about a 15-year-old boy, Will. When Will’s brother, Shawn, is shot, everything turns downhill. Will’s father also died, so all he has is his mother; who is devoured in grief after the death of his son. But Will has no time to grieve; he must stick to the rules:

Rule #1: NO CRYING

Rule #2: NO SNITCHING

Rule #3: TAKE REVENGE

Touching Spirit Bear is a fictional novel written by Ben Mikaelsen. Cole Matthews is a 15-year-old. From stealing goods to starting fights, he was nothing but trouble. One day, he robbed and destroyed a store. The police wouldn’t have found out about it if it weren’t for Peter Driscal, a freshman at Cole’s school. Overwhelmed with anger, Cole beats up Peter, smashing his head to the ground. Now his punishment would be even worse.
